  • Patent number: 11602045
    Abstract: An elastic mounting board that includes: a first elastic substrate; an elastic wiring on a first main surface of the first elastic substrate; an electrode electrically connected to the elastic wiring; and a functional component mounted in a mounting portion of the first elastic substrate and electrically connected to the elastic wiring, in which the mounting portion having the functional component is folded back such that the functional component will face a first main surface side of the elastic mounting board and the electrode will face a second main surface side of the elastic mounting board.

  • Patent number: 11490515
    Abstract: An extensible and contractible wiring board includes first and second extensible and contractible wiring substrates formed by respective wiring at extensible and contractible substrates. Each of the first and second extensible and contractible wiring substrates has a first end having functional units and an intermediate wiring portion, with the wiring and the functional units of the first and second extensible and contractible wiring substrates not electrically connected. Moreover, the first and second extensible and contractible wiring substrates are electrically independent extensible and contractible wiring substrates, and the wirings and the functional units do not overlap at the first ends of the first and second extensible and contractible wiring substrates in top view of the extensible and contractible wiring board, and the intermediate wiring portions of the first and second extensible and contractible wiring substrates overlap in top view of the extensible and contractible wiring board.

  • Publication number: 20210100511
    Abstract: A living body-attachable electrode is provided with a first stretchable substrate. A conductive pattern may be provided on one main surface of the first stretchable substrate and including an electrode part and a wiring part connected to the electrode part. A second stretchable substrate may be provided on the one main surface of the first stretchable substrate to cover at least the wiring part of the conductive pattern and having an opening exposing at least a part of the electrode part. A gel electrode may be provided in the opening of the second stretchable substrate and conductive to the electrode part, in which the gel electrode is provided on a main surface of the second stretchable substrate to spread outward from the opening of the second stretchable substrate. The main surface may not be in contact with the first stretchable substrate.

  • Patent number: 10888276
    Abstract: A living body-attachable electrode includes a substrate that has a first main surface and a second main surface and is made of a material having stretchability, a first electrode pair that is formed on/in the first main surface and includes two opposite electrodes, a second electrode pair that is formed on/in the first main surface and includes two opposite electrodes sandwiching the first electrode pair, and a plurality of gel electrodes that are formed on the second main surface and are in a one-to-one correspondence with the electrodes in the first and second electrode pairs. Each of the electrodes in the first and second electrode pairs and corresponding one of the gel electrodes are electrically connected to each other via a plurality of via conductors penetrating through the substrate.
